📍 Top Attractions

St. Sophia Cathedral: This UNESCO World Heritage site features beautiful mosaics and frescoes. Visitor Tip: Visit early in the day to avoid crowds and fully appreciate its history.

Kyiv Pechersk Lavra: A historic monastery complex known for its caves and stunning architecture, visitors can learn about its spiritual significance and explore its serene grounds.

Maidan Nezalezhnosti (Independence Square): The central square of Kyiv is rich in history and a gathering place for locals. Travelers can enjoy street performances and nearby cafes.

Travel Tips for Ukraine

💡 Essential Logistics & Insider Tips for Ukraine, Ukraine

🚆 Getting Around

The Core Tip: Public transportation is a common way to navigate cities in Ukraine, with options including buses, trams, and metro systems, especially in larger cities like Kyiv and Lviv.

The Pro Move: To avoid heavy traffic, consider traveling during off-peak hours or using the metro in cities where it is available, as it can significantly cut down travel time.

📅 Timing Your Trip

The Core Tip: The summer months (June to August) are peak tourist season, featuring warm weather and various outdoor festivals, while winter offers unique holiday markets.

The Pro Move: For less crowded experiences, visit major attractions early in the morning or on weekdays, particularly at popular sites like St. Sophia Cathedral.

🚶 Getting Around Safely

The Core Tip: Many urban areas in Ukraine are walkable, particularly historical districts that host attractions, shops, and restaurants.

The Pro Move: Travelers should remain vigilant and stick to well-lit areas after dark, especially in unfamiliar neighborhoods, to ensure a safe experience.

💳 Money & Payments

The Core Tip: Most establishments in Ukraine, including hotels and larger restaurants, accept credit cards, though small vendors may prefer cash.

The Pro Move: It's wise to carry some cash for local markets or street vendors where card payments might not be accepted.

✈️ Airport / Arrival Tips

The Core Tip: Upon arrival at major airports such as Boryspil International Airport in Kyiv, travelers can find taxis and rideshare services readily available for transfer into the city.

The Pro Move: Following airport signage to the designated taxi or rideshare pickup areas can save time and ensure a smooth transition to your accommodation.
